A man reportedly pulled down a child's trousers at the Dragon King restaurant in Letchworth.
The incident was reported to Herts police at around 8.20pm on Wednesday, May 17.
According to a spokesperson for Hertfordshire Constabulary, "it is reported that a man pulled down the trousers of a child, and he apologised to the family".
Police officers subsequently spoke to the family of the child, who were unsupportive of police action.

Words of advice have been given to the man involved and no further action will be taken.
Dragon King have been contacted for comment on this story.
